Clinicians aren’t chasing perfection. They’re looking for practicality, professionalism and a place that lets them get straight to work.
First, they want a clean, well-presented space.
It doesn’t need to be brand new or architecturally designed. It just needs to feel safe, professional and ready for patients. If your clinic already runs day-to-day, you’re likely ticking this box without even realising.
Second, they value location more than luxury.
Accessibility matters. Parking, public transport, street presence. If your clinic is easy to find and easy to access, you’re already ahead of many options out there.
Third, they want flexibility.
Most clinicians don’t want to commit to long leases or high overheads. They’re testing, growing, or expanding. Offering part-time, daily, or session-based access makes your space far more attractive than rigid agreements.
Fourth, they’re looking for an environment they can trust.
That means being surrounded by other professionals, operating within a compliant setting and knowing the basics are handled. Cleanliness, structure and consistency go a long way.
Fifth, they want simplicity.
Clear pricing. Straightforward terms. No confusion. The easier it is to understand and say yes, the faster your room gets filled.
